A cultural and scientific history of the Moon from prehistoric archaeology to the most recent technological and scientific research today.

LONGLISTED FOR THE NATIONAL BOOK AWARD 2024


Every living being throughout history, across time and geography, has gazed up at the same moon.

From the first prehistoric life that crawled onto land to the present day, the Moon has driven the expansion and development of our world, inspired scientific discovery and culture, and stirred an inexhaustible desire to know where we come from and how we got here.

As astronauts around the world prepare to return to the Moon - opening up new frontiers of discovery, profit and politics - Our Moon tells the dazzling story of how the Moon has shaped life as we know it, fuelled dramatic change across the globe and could be the key to humanity's future.

About the Author

Rebecca Boyle is an award-winning science writer. She writes for The Atlantic, the New York Times, New Scientist, Popular Science, Smithsonian Air & Space, and many other publications. She is a member of the group science blog The Last Word on Nothing. Boyle was a Knight Science Journalism Fellow at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, and has been the recipient of numerous writing awards throughout her career. Her work has been anthologised three times in The Best American Science & Nature Writing. Boyle is a former newspaper reporter, a former Space Camp attendee, and a lifelong Moon enthusiast.
